Items needed?
1. All your working accessories already on your car that you want to reuse except the oil pump and timing chain (already installed);
2. Probably new motor mounts;
3. Heads & intake with gaskets;
4. PCM tune.
I'd also recommend 30LB to 36LB injectors (no need to go bigger). A cam is already installed.....which you can choose to keep or sell.

The rotating assembly would be good to 7K+ RPMs.....the true limit will depend on your valve train.
Quote:
Originally Posted by Xzauhst
.........Also I'm an f body, not a b body just to clear that.
|
Yep....that's why I say use ALL your accessories already on the car.
This engine won't come with any mounting brackets, so you'll need to have your block pulled, stripped, and those stripped parts placed on this block.
Do that.....and you'd be good to go  !
